The Hayward Area Historical Society serves as a bridge between people, memories, and narratives. Offering a range of engaging programs and events, the society invites visitors to explore local history through exhibits and guided tours at historic sites like Meek Mansion and McConaghy House.
With educational resources tailored for researchers, schools, and volunteers, the society actively promotes the preservation and sharing of Hayward's rich heritage. Visitors can delve into the past through the society's diverse collections, which include artifacts, photographs, and documents that highlight the area's cultural evolution.
